    I whole heartdely disagree with the first half of that statement lol, but not looking to turn this into a 2 stroke vs. 4 stroke debate haha. The issue of 2 stroke vs 4 stroke isn't why this bike is superior to the ttr, it's because of the suspension mainly, the frame, and the weight savings. Oh and lets not forget that YZ125's make 33 horsepower stock whereas TTR's make a solid 11 horsepower.

    TTR's make great cabin bikes that everyone in the family can enjoy from grandmas to grandsons :biggrin: but at 20 years old I'll take a fairly high hp bike that revs to 13k with a great, stiff suspension.
